Music startup Roqbot has secured a big-name retail partner to trial its social DJ app. It’s working with The Gap, albeit in only one store in San Francisco. There, customers who have Roqbot’s app on their phones will be able to choose songs from its catalogue of six million songs to play – while seeing their avatar appear on the in-store screens.
The trial will run until early 2012, with the possibility of being extended to other stores if it’s successful. The Gap is one of the first companies to hop on board Roqbot’s new Roqbot for Retail service, which it’s rolling out in partnership with Cisco. “They were looking for a better way to engage their customers around music,” co-founder Garrett Dodge tells VentureBeat.
